1. Visible Cracks Are Getting Larger
Small surface cracks are common in concrete, but they should never be ignored. Over time, minor cracks can expand due to heavy equipment, vehicle traffic, temperature changes, and moisture infiltration.
Warning signs include:
Cracks becoming wider or longer
Multiple interconnected cracks
Uneven crack edges
Water entering through cracks
Once moisture reaches the foundation beneath the concrete, the damage can accelerate quickly. Professional repairs help restore structural integrity before larger sections of the floor are affected.

2. Surface Pitting and Spalling
If the top layer of your concrete begins to chip, flake, or peel away, the floor is experiencing spalling. This type of damage often develops because of heavy traffic, freeze and thaw cycles, chemical exposure, or poor installation.
Common indicators include:
Rough surface texture
Small holes appearing across the floor
Loose concrete fragments
Exposed aggregate
Surface deterioration not only affects appearance but also creates trip hazards and increases maintenance costs. Professional repair can restore the damaged areas and prevent further deterioration.
3. Uneven or Sunken Sections
Concrete floors should remain level to support equipment, shelving, and foot traffic safely. If portions of the floor begin sinking or settling, immediate evaluation is recommended.
Possible causes include:
Soil movement
Water erosion beneath the slab
Poor ground compaction
Heavy structural loads
Uneven flooring can create serious safety risks while placing additional stress on machinery and storage systems. Repair specialists can identify the root cause and recommend the most effective restoration method.
4. Persistent Stains and Chemical Damage
Industrial facilities often experience exposure to oils, solvents, grease, and harsh chemicals. Without proper cleaning and maintenance, these substances can gradually weaken concrete surfaces.
Signs of chemical damage include:
Permanent discoloration
Surface softening
Etching
Material breakdown

5. Dusting on the Concrete Surface
Concrete dusting occurs when the surface begins producing fine powder during normal use. While it may seem like a minor issue, dusting often indicates surface degradation.
You may notice:
Fine gray dust after sweeping
Increased airborne particles
Dirty equipment despite regular cleaning
Reduced floor appearance
Dusting can affect indoor air quality and increase maintenance requirements throughout the facility. Professional treatment can strengthen the concrete surface and reduce ongoing deterioration.

6. Water Pooling After Cleaning
Standing water on concrete floors may indicate that the surface has become uneven or that drainage issues are developing.
Watch for:
Water collecting in specific areas
Slow drying after cleaning
Slippery surfaces
Moisture stains
Pooling water accelerates concrete deterioration and increases the likelihood of slips and falls. It may also contribute to mold growth and damage surrounding equipment.
Professional repair can restore proper floor leveling while helping improve drainage across the facility.
7. Frequent Repairs in the Same Area
If you find yourself repeatedly patching the same section of concrete, the underlying problem may require professional attention.
Temporary fixes may not address issues such as:
Structural weakness
Foundation movement
Moisture intrusion
Heavy load damage
Rather than continuing to apply short term repairs, investing in professional restoration provides a more durable and cost effective solution.
